Early Life
Timothée Hal Chalamet was born on December 27, 1995, in New York City, United States. He grew up in Manhattan in a creative and culturally rich environment. His mother, Nicole Flender, worked in real estate and had experience as a Broadway dancer, while his father, Marc Chalamet, worked as an editor and correspondent.
Chalamet has both American and French heritage, allowing him to spend time in France during his childhood. Growing up bilingual gave him a broader cultural perspective that has influenced both his personal life and career.
From an early age, Timothée showed a passion for acting and storytelling. He attended the prestigious Fiorello H. LaGuardia High School of Music & Art and Performing Arts, where he honed his acting skills and participated in various stage productions.
Beginning His Acting Career
Timothée Chalamet began acting as a child by appearing in commercials and short films. He later secured small television roles in popular series, including:
- Homeland
- Law & Order
- Royal Pains
These early experiences helped him gain confidence and industry recognition while building the foundation for a successful acting career.
His first significant film appearance came in Men, Women & Children (2014), directed by Jason Reitman. He also appeared in Christopher Nolan’s science fiction epic Interstellar, playing the younger version of Tom Cooper.
Breakthrough with Call Me by Your Name
Timothée’s breakthrough arrived in 2017 with his leading role in Call Me by Your Name, where he portrayed Elio Perlman.
His emotionally powerful performance received widespread praise from critics worldwide. At just 22 years old, he became one of the youngest nominees for the Academy Award for Best Actor in decades.
The film established him as one of the most promising actors of his generation and opened the door to many prestigious opportunities.
Career Growth and Major Films
Following his breakthrough, Timothée Chalamet carefully selected diverse roles that showcased his acting range.
Some of his most notable films include:
Lady Bird (2017)
A coming-of-age comedy-drama directed by Greta Gerwig that earned multiple Academy Award nominations.
Beautiful Boy (2018)
Chalamet portrayed a young man struggling with drug addiction alongside Steve Carell, earning praise for his emotionally intense performance.
Little Women (2019)
He played Theodore “Laurie” Laurence in Greta Gerwig’s acclaimed adaptation of Louisa May Alcott’s classic novel.
The King (2019)
Timothée starred as King Henry V in this historical drama, demonstrating his ability to lead major productions.
Dune (2021 & 2024)
One of the biggest milestones in his career came when he portrayed Paul Atreides in Denis Villeneuve’s epic science fiction adaptation of Dune. The films became worldwide successes and further elevated his global profile.
Wonka (2023)
Chalamet impressed audiences by portraying a young Willy Wonka, showcasing not only his acting abilities but also his singing and dancing talents.
